Yesterday at Delaware State University, students from New Castle, Kent, & Sussex County joined DE Secretary of State Jeffrey Bullock for the 2024 convening of the electoral college. Three electors cast ballots for Kamala Harris for President & Tim Walz for VP, winners of the popular vote in DE.

For the 1st time this school year, Delaware public school teachers have access to 20 model lessons to teach 3rd graders about Native history, including the Lenape and Nanticoke people, who originally lived here, and continue to this day. #SSChat #ITeachSocialStudies

The DE Center for Civics Education provides resources and support for teaching and learning aligned to civics & history standards to support preservice & professional educators preparing students for college, careers, and civic life. Learn more at www.udel.edu/academics/co...
